Q: Is 10,878 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 10,878 is a composite number.

Why is 10,878 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 10,878 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 7 14 21 37 42 49 74 98 111 147 222 259 294 518 777 1,554 1,813 3,626 5,439 and 10,878, with no remainder.

Since 10,878 cannot be divided by just 1 and 10,878, it is a composite number.
